Output 668123cd56f1a73ae31437a368bcc610c0de9e3559dcb0ab59f7258fd5a50d95:639

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e9da4333f2d5789b88962329e41d3453fdb9be831bc9a5f65b2f2369fdea82cc
address
tb1pa8dyxvlj64ufhzykyv57g8f5207mn05rr0y6tajm9u3knl02stxqq6msjd
transaction
668123cd56f1a73ae31437a368bcc610c0de9e3559dcb0ab59f7258fd5a50d95